Output 28667effcd60e732062b957432b8d4b53ae8334a196dca3e5830305b6ffac2a5:1

value
43063
script pubkey
OP_0 OP_PUSHBYTES_20 da8e16af1e54055b83f733c739b899a71b1e1963
address
bc1qm28pdtc72sz4hqlhx0rnnwye5ud3uxtrztt832
transaction
28667effcd60e732062b957432b8d4b53ae8334a196dca3e5830305b6ffac2a5